Q » What is the difference between a critical path activity and a non-critical activity?
17 Oct, 2025
A » In construction project management, a critical path activity is one that directly affects the project's completion date, as any delay will extend the overall timeline. Conversely, a non-critical activity has some scheduling flexibility, meaning delays won't impact the project's end date if managed within its float time. Understanding these differences helps prioritize tasks and allocate resources efficiently.
